Therapeutic Approaches and Online Care



Aquita Burrus uses evidence-informed approaches tailored to each person's needs.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, or CBT, helps people identify and change unhelpful thinking and behavior patterns to reduce symptoms of anxiety and depression and improve daily functioning.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ing, known as EMDR, is an approach often used for trauma and post-traumatic stress to help process distressing memories and reduce their emotional intensity. Mindfulness therapy teaches present-moment awareness and simple practices to manage stress, regulate emotions, and increase self-compassion.
